Printing Issue

When printing the ROI YIELD and DISTRIBUTION SUMMARY reports, the leftmost portion of each line is truncated -- about half the first letter. I've tried adjusting the L/R margins and font size and that makes no difference in the truncation. Other reports print correctly.
Hi elliots,
If you look in the "Print Preview" is it truncated there as well?
Hi elliots,
I suspect this is some problem specific to your printer or driver. Fund Manager uses the same code to draw the Print Preview window as it sends to the printer, so they should be identical. I also just did a test print of these reports here, and they printed properly. I'd suggest seeing if your printer has an updated driver available. Do you have another printer you can try printing on?
Mark,
I think I've got it fixed. First, I was wrong -- it did show on the preview. It appears that the problem was that I was setting to close a L Margin. When set to 0.25, I get the clipping; at 0.30 it's fine. Some of your reports seem pretty wide for letter size paper. On the Distribution Summary report I had to reduce the font to 8 with margins of 0.3/0.25 and also some column width adjustments.
Hi elliots,
Great, glad you fixed it. Yes, some printers aren't able to print that close to the edge of the paper.
